Loreto College, located at 6A Middleton Row in the heart of Kolkata, is one of the oldest and most prestigious women's colleges in India. Established in 1912 by the Institute of the Blessed Virgin Mary (IBVM), it is affiliated with the University of Calcutta and is a minority institution.
The college is consistently ranked among the Top Arts and Science Colleges in West Bengal and draws students from across the state and country. Its central Kolkata location, strong academic reputation, and experienced faculty make it a top choice for female students after their Higher Secondary (HS) exams.

Loreto College offers 3-year undergraduate degree programs under the University of Calcutta framework. Admissions are available in Honours and General (Programme) Courses across three streams.
| Subject | Seats (Approx) | Stream |
|---|---|---|
| English | 70 | Arts |
| Bengali | 70 | Arts |
| Hindi | 50 | Arts |
| History | 60 | Arts |
| Political Science | 55 | Arts |
| Philosophy | 50 | Arts |
| Economics | 50 | Arts |
| Sociology | 45 | Arts |
| Psychology | 45 | Arts |
| Subject | Seats (Approx) | Stream |
|---|---|---|
| Physics | 40 | Science |
| Chemistry | 40 | Science |
| Mathematics | 40 | Science |
| Botany | 35 | Science |
| Zoology | 35 | Science |
| Microbiology | 30 | Science |
| Computer Science | 30 | Science |
Loreto College offers BCom (Honours) and BCom (General/Programme) courses. BCom Honours is among the most sought-after programmes at the college due to its strong placement support and campus environment.

Admission to Loreto College is conducted entirely through the University of Calcutta's centralized online admissions portal. There is no separate Entrance Exam. Selection is based on merit (HS/Class 12 marks).
Register on CU Admission Portal
Create an account on the official University of Calcutta undergraduate admissions portal. You will need your HS roll number, board details, and a valid email/mobile number.
Fill the Application Form & Choose Loreto College
Select Loreto College and your desired Honours/General subject from the dropdown list. You can apply for multiple subjects across multiple colleges in one application. Pay the application fee online (approximately ₹200–₹500).
Merit List Publication
The University of Calcutta publishes merit lists for all Affiliated Colleges including Loreto College. Multiple rounds of merit lists are released until seats are filled. Check the portal regularly.
Seat Acceptance & Fee Payment
If your name appears in the merit list, you must accept the seat within the given deadline and pay the first semester/year fees online through the portal.
Document Verification at College
After online seat confirmation, visit Loreto College for physical document verification. Bring original and attested copies of HS marksheet, admit card, Aadhaar, caste certificate (if applicable), and two passport photos.
Loreto College is a government-aided minority institution under the University of Calcutta. Its fees are regulated and significantly lower compared to private colleges. Below is an approximate fee breakdown:
| Fee Component | Arts / Commerce | Science |
|---|---|---|
| University Registration & Affiliation | ₹1,500 – ₹2,000 | ₹1,500 – ₹2,000 |
| Development / Infrastructure Fee | ₹500 – ₹800 | ₹800 – ₹1,200 |
| Library / Sports / Cultural Activities | ₹300 – ₹500 | ₹300 – ₹500 |
| Lab Fee (Science only) | — | ₹1,000 – ₹2,000 |
| Estimated Total (1st Year) | ₹5,000 – ₹7,000 | ₹7,000 – ₹11,000 |
Loreto College follows the University of Calcutta's centralized admission schedule. Approximate timeline for the 2026 session:
| Event | Expected Timeline (2026) |
|---|---|
| HS Result Declaration (WBCHSE) | Late May / Early June 2026 |
| CU Admission Portal Opens | June 2026 |
| Online Application Window | June – July 2026 |
| 1st Merit List Publication | July 2026 |
| 2nd & 3rd Merit List (if needed) | July – August 2026 |
| Admission & Fee Payment Deadline | As per each merit list window |
| Document Verification at College | July – August 2026 |
| Classes Begin (1st Year) | August / September 2026 |

Loreto College annual fees are approximately ₹5,000–₹7,000 for Arts and Commerce courses, and ₹7,000–₹11,000 for Science courses (including lab fees), for the first year. These are indicative figures based on previous years. Official fees for 2026 will be published by the college and the University of Calcutta during the admission process.
Yes. Loreto College Kolkata is a women's college. Admissions are open to female candidates only. It is a minority institution run by the Institute of the Blessed Virgin Mary (IBVM).
There is no fixed minimum marks cutoff — Loreto College uses a merit list based on the University of Calcutta's best-of-4 calculation. Historically, the effective cutoff for popular subjects like English Honours, Physics Honours, and Economics Honours has been 88–94%. For less competitive subjects, the cutoff may be lower. Scoring above 85% in your best 4 subjects is a safe starting target.
The first merit list for Loreto College 2026 is expected in July 2026, following the University of Calcutta's centralized schedule. The exact date will be announced on the official CU admissions portal. Subsequent merit lists may follow if seats remain vacant.
Yes. The University of Calcutta accepts applications from students who have passed Class 12 from CBSE, ICSE/ISC, WBCHSE, or any other recognized national or state board. The merit calculation applies a conversion formula to normalize marks across boards.
Yes. SC/ST/OBC and minority community students can apply for State Government Scholarships through the West Bengal scholarship portal. The college also has its own welfare fund for economically weaker students. Additionally, high-performing students may be eligible for merit scholarships from the University of Calcutta.
